The Benefits Of Pursuing A Physics Foundation Degree

A physics foundation degree provides students with a strong foundation in the fundamental principles of physics. It serves as a stepping stone towards further study and a career in the field of physics. This article will explore the benefits of pursuing a physics foundation degree, as well as the opportunities it opens up for students.

First and foremost, a physics foundation degree equips students with a solid understanding of the basic concepts of physics. This includes topics such as classical mechanics, electromagnetism, thermal physics, quantum mechanics, and relativity. By mastering these core principles, students are better prepared to tackle more advanced topics in physics. This strong foundation sets the stage for further study at the undergraduate or postgraduate level.

In addition to academic knowledge, a physics foundation degree also develops students’ critical thinking and problem-solving skills. Physics is a discipline that requires analytical thinking and the ability to reason logically. By grappling with complex concepts and solving challenging problems, students hone these essential skills. These skills are valuable not only in the field of physics but also in a wide range of other professions.

Furthermore, a physics foundation degree provides students with practical laboratory experience. Physics is an experimental science, and hands-on laboratory work is a key component of learning the subject. Through experiments and practical exercises, students gain a deeper understanding of the concepts they are studying. They also learn important lab techniques and develop their abilities to collect, analyze, and interpret data.

Another benefit of pursuing a physics foundation degree is the versatility it offers. Physics is a fundamental science that underpins many other disciplines, including engineering, astronomy, materials science, and computer science. A physics foundation degree opens up pathways to a wide range of careers, both within the field of physics and beyond. Graduates may choose to pursue further study in a specialized area of physics or enter industries such as research, telecommunications, finance, or education.

Moreover, a physics foundation degree can lead to exciting and rewarding career opportunities. Physics graduates are in high demand in a variety of industries, including technology, aerospace, healthcare, and energy. They may work in research and development, design and engineering, data analysis, or teaching. Physics is a versatile degree that opens doors to a range of well-paid and fulfilling careers.
